Contribution of heritable disorders to mortality in the pediatric intensive care unit

Heritable disorders cause 19% of pediatric intensive care unit (PICU) deaths. Vital statistics often fail to record these genetic conditions, undercounting their impact.

Area of Science:

  • Medical Genetics
  • Pediatric Critical Care
  • Public Health Statistics

Background:

  • Heritable disorders represent a significant, yet often underrecognized, cause of mortality in pediatric intensive care units (PICUs).
  • Accurate identification of underlying causes of death is crucial for public health surveillance and targeted interventions.

Purpose of the Study:

  • To quantify the proportion of deaths in the PICU attributable to heritable disorders.
  • To compare the accuracy of vital statistics in classifying the cause of death versus detailed medical record review.

Main Methods:

  • A retrospective review of medical records for all deaths in a university-affiliated PICU over a 5-year period.
  • Detailed analysis of patients with suspected heritable conditions, including genetic evaluation status.
  • Comparison of identified heritable disorders with the underlying cause of death listed in vital statistics.

Main Results:

  • Heritable disorders accounted for 19% (51 of 268) of all PICU deaths.
  • These included chromosome abnormalities, recognized syndromes, and developmental defects.
  • Vital statistics failed to identify the underlying heritable disorder in 41% of these cases.

Conclusions:

  • Heritable disorders are a substantial contributor to PICU mortality.
  • Current vital statistics classification systems underascertain heritable disorders as a cause of death.
  • Improved classification methods are needed for accurate public health data and interventions.
